Analysis
In 2023, net bilateral aid flows from dac donors, total (current us$), per in Nicaragua stood at 1,412 current US$ per square kilometre.
Compared with earlier readings it is up 4.9% on the previous year and down 29.4% over ten years.
Over the whole period, net bilateral aid flows from dac donors, total (current us$), per in Nicaragua peaked at 7,628 current US$ per square kilometre in 2004 and was at its lowest, 58.33 current US$ per square kilometre, in 1962.
That places Nicaragua 106th out of 178 countries with data for 2023, putting it in the middle of the range.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

How this figure is calculated
Net bilateral aid flows from DAC donors, Total (current US$) divided by Land area (sq. km), mat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.
Net bilateral aid flows from DAC donors, Total (current US$) ÷ Land area (sq. km)
Computed from
- Net bilateral aid flows from DAC donors, Total Development Assistance Committee, Organisation for Economic Co-operation and Development (OECD)
- Land area FAOSTAT, Food and Agriculture Organization of the United Nations (FAO)
Statizoid computes this series; the underlying measurements belong to the publishers named above. The arithmetic is applied to every country and year where both inputs report, and nothing is estimated unless the page says so.
